SaaSHub helps you find the best software and product alternatives Learn more →
Top 13 Java Golang Projects
-
ANTLR
ANTLR (ANother Tool for Language Recognition) is a powerful parser generator for reading, processing, executing, or translating structured text or binary files.
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
-
open-location-code
Open Location Code is a library to generate short codes, called "plus codes", that can be used as digital addresses where street addresses don't exist.
-
incubator-fury
A blazingly fast multi-language serialization framework powered by JIT and zero-copy.
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
-
oneML-bootcamp
Intro and sample apps to showcase oneML functionalities and possible use cases: Face Detection, Face Identification, Face Embedding, Vehicle Detection, EKYC, Person Attack Detection.
antlr https://github.com/antlr/antlr4
Project mention: Ask HN: Does (or why does) anyone use MapReduce anymore? | news.ycombinator.com | 2024-01-24The "streaming systems" book answers your question and more: https://www.oreilly.com/library/view/streaming-systems/97814.... It gives you a history of how batch processing started with MapReduce, and how attempts at scaling by moving towards streaming systems gave us all the subsequent frameworks (Spark, Beam, etc.).
As for the framework called MapReduce, it isn't used much, but its descendant https://beam.apache.org very much is. Nowadays people often use "map reduce" as a shorthand for whatever batch processing system they're building on top of.
Project mention: A Critical Analysis of the What3Words Geocoding Algorithm | news.ycombinator.com | 2023-09-02Pluscode is a trademark. The actual standard is called "open location code" and is unrestricted - https://github.com/google/open-location-code/
Project mention: Rethinking string encoding: a 37.5% space efficient encoding than UTF-8 in Fury | news.ycombinator.com | 2024-05-07For implemetation details, https://github.com/apache/incubator-fury/blob/main/java/fury... can be taken as an example
Project mention: [Maven] Configuring exec-maven to run command line command | /r/javahelp | 2023-05-24Have you considered using something like https://github.com/raydac/mvn-golang ? It seems built specifically for this kind of purpose. It also works with multiple versions of go; the default is 1.18, but I just changed it to 1.20.4 and it worked fine.
Java Golang related posts
-
Stirling-PDF: local web application to perform various operations on PDFs
-
Show HN: Advent of Distributed Systems
-
The Developer-First Security Week free event (Aug 7-11)
-
Cloud backup
-
[Maven] Configuring exec-maven to run command line command
-
Kafka alternatives
-
Cloud backup for mobile
-
A note from our sponsor - SaaSHub
www.saashub.com | 23 May 2024
Index
What are some of the best open-source Golang projects in Java? This list will help you:
Project | Stars | |
---|---|---|
1 | ANTLR | 16,504 |
2 | beam | 7,573 |
3 | open-location-code | 4,022 |
4 | zeebe | 3,046 |
5 | SBE | 3,028 |
6 | incubator-fury | 2,669 |
7 | colfer | 733 |
8 | IPAddress | 438 |
9 | mvn-golang | 161 |
10 | smithy-go | 152 |
11 | oneML-bootcamp | 11 |
12 | terratest-maven-plugin | 6 |
13 | GoJavaWasm | 1 |
Sponsored